Code P1D7F Dodge Description
The P1D7F diagnostic trouble code (DTC) for Dodge vehicles indicates an Electronic Throttle Control (ETC) Self-Learning Failure. The Electronic Throttle Control system is responsible for managing the throttle opening in response to driver input, ensuring smooth acceleration and engine performance. When the ETC system is unable to self-learn properly, it can lead to various performance issues and potentially compromise the vehicle's drivability.
Common Causes of P1D7F Dodge
- Faulty throttle position sensor
- Wiring or connection issues in the ETC system
- Software glitches in the electronic control module
- Dirty throttle body or throttle plate
- Mechanical issues with the throttle actuator
Symptoms of P1D7F Dodge
- Erratic throttle response
- Engine hesitation or surging
- Vehicle stalling or difficulty starting
- Reduced engine power or limp mode activation
How to Fix P1D7F Dodge
- Diagnose the ETC system using a scan tool to pinpoint the exact cause of the self-learning failure.
- Inspect and test the throttle position sensor for proper operation and replace if necessary.
- Check and clean the throttle body and throttle plate to ensure smooth operation.
- Verify the wiring and connections in the ETC system for any damage or corrosion.
- Reset the ETC system and perform a throttle relearn procedure to recalibrate the system.
Cost to Fix P1D7F Dodge
The typical repair costs for addressing an Electronic Throttle Control Self-Learning Failure can vary depending on the specific cause and the extent of the issue. Generally, the parts required for this repair, such as a new throttle position sensor or throttle body cleaning supplies, can range from $50 to $200. Labor costs at an auto repair shop can add an additional $100 to $300, considering the diagnosis time and actual repair work involved.
